Atlanta teachers, it’s your week! National Teacher Appreciation Week runs May 4–8, 2026, and local restaurants and national chains with plenty of Atlanta locations are rolling out discounts, free meals, and specials to say thank you.
Always bring a valid school ID, check with specific locations (participation can vary by franchise), and call ahead to confirm details. For larger and longer deals, check out our Atlanta Food Specials Guide.
Teacher Appreciation Week 2026: Atlanta Deals & Freebies
Here’s a roundup of standout food deals available this week in the Atlanta area:
Chick-fil-A (Atlanta HQ favorite)

Many participating Chick-fil-A locations are offering teachers a free Chick-fil-A Chicken Sandwich or similar item (like Chick-n-Minis or 8-count Nuggets) on Tuesday, May 5 (or throughout the week—varies by store). Show your school ID. Check your nearest location via their social media or by calling, as offers are franchise-specific.
Applebee’s
From May 4–8, enjoy a free appetizer or dessert (up to $12 value) with the purchase of an entrée at participating locations. Flynn-operated spots in Georgia often participate. A BOGO entrée voucher for later use may also be available at select spots.
Buffalo Wild Wings
20% off dine-in orders for teachers and school staff showing a valid school ID, available through May 10 at Atlanta-area locations.
McAlister’s Deli
Free 32 oz tea (sweet or unsweet) with educator ID at participating locations from May 4–8. Perfect for those long planning periods.
Einstein Bros. Bagels
On May 6, get a free Bagel & Shmear of your choice with any purchase when you show your teacher or nurse ID.
Chipotle
Enter for a chance to win one of 100,000 free burrito e-gift cards through May 12 via Chipotle’s Teacher Thanks site. Winners are selected randomly—worth a quick entry!
More Notable Deals Across Atlanta Chains
- Grimaldi’s Pizzeria: 15% off all orders May 4–8 with valid school ID (nationwide, including Atlanta spots).
- Capriotti’s: 20% off in-store orders through May 12.
- Potbelly: Free cookie or regular fountain drink with any entrée purchase (May 4–12).
- Whataburger: Free breakfast menu item (e.g., Honey Butter Chicken Biscuit) on Thursday, May 7, from 5–9 a.m. with school ID.
- Beef ‘O’ Brady’s and similar spots: Often 15% off—check local listings.

Pro Tips for Atlanta Teachers:
- Deals are first-come, first-served and often limited to one per teacher.
- Some require dine-in; others work for takeout.
- Verify via restaurant apps/websites, as offers can change.
